FY2026 Budget Adopted

Westminster, MD, Thursday, May 22, 2025 – Today, during Open Session, the Carroll County Board of Commissioners adopted the Fiscal Year 2026 Budget, which begins July 1, 2025. The adopted FY2026 Budget will be available for public viewing on the county’s website as soon as possible. All information in this adopted budget is final.
The $580.7 million General Fund, which authorizes day-to-day expenses, sees an increase of $35.6 million, or 6.5%, from FY2025. The budget does not include any tax increases for FY2026. The budget ordinance does include fee increases for water and sewer as well as solid waste.
The county’s FY 26 operating budget is funded 48% from property tax, 36% from income tax, and 3% from recordation, with the remainder supported by additional revenue sources, including building permits, 911 service fees, investment income, and others.
